The following is from the Arcade Museum
One or two players choose a ballclub from cities like New York, Chicago, Los Angeles, Atlanta, or Boston and compete either against the computer or each other in this baseball game. A wide variety of picthes can be thrown and batters can change their stance and angle of swing.
Bottom Of The Ninth was produced by Konami in 1989.
Konami released 442 machines in our database under this trade name, starting in 1978. Konami was based in Japan.
Other machines made by Konami during the time period Bottom Of The Ninth was produced include: ’88 Games, Chequered Flag, Akumajou Dracula, Crazy Cop, Contra (PlayChoice), Gradius III, M.I.A. Missing In Action, Cue Brick, Crime Fighters, and Block Hole
